Substrate‐directed diastereoselective hydroformylation: key step for the assembly of polypropionate subunits
Abstract o-DPPB-Directed hydroformylation could serve as a key step for the construction of bifunctionalized stereotriad building blocks, which form the basis of polyketide natural products (see scheme). | Summary: | Abstract o-DPPB-Directed hydroformylation could serve as a key step for the construction of bifunctionalized stereotriad building blocks, which form the basis of polyketide natural products (see scheme). The prepared building blocks are well suited to permit polyketide chain extensions into both directions of the main chain. o-DPPB=ortho-diphenylphosphanylbenzoyl. |
